Nestled in the heart of County Durham, Allens West train station serves as a humble yet vital hub for everyday commuters and travelers in the Teesside region. Whether you're a local resident looking to travel for work, or a visitor aiming to explore the vibrant North East of England, Allens West station offers a practical starting point for your journey.
Allens West is a modest station equipped with essential fac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th transit experience. Though it does not have a ticket office or staffed help,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ting train tickets. Smartcard holders are in luck, as issuance is possible here, although there's no validator present. The station is dedicated to passenger safety and convenience—with CCTV monitoring and an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ments.
Accessibility wise, the station supports step-free access making it a Category B station, thus ensuring ease of movement for wheelchair users. Assistance for passengers with mobility needs can be sought directly on the platform. There are no public restrooms or refreshment facilities, so it's best to prepare ahead if embarking on a long journey.
The station is conveniently linked to various modes of transport. Visitors will find a rail replacement service operating adjacent to the level crossing. For those needing a taxi, bookings can be made easily via a handy online service, offering connectivity to the surrounding areas. Unfortunately, b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, but secured storage for personal bicycles is provided.

Nestled in the London Borough of Croydon, Purley Train Station serves as a vibrant gateway for both locals and visitors traveling across the UK. With its strategic location on the Brighton Main Line, the station is a favored choice for commuters heading into Central London and beyond. Whether you're a first-time visitor or a regular commuter, Purley Station offers a blend of accessibility and convenience, making it a bustling hub for rail travel.
Purley Station prides itself on providing comprehensive facilities designed to meet the diverse need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from early morning till evening, ensuring travelers can conveniently purchase and collect their tickets. There are ticket machines situated for ease of access, capable of processing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. For those traveling with accessibility challenges, the station boasts step-free access throughout and provides staffed assistance, ensuring a seamless travel experience for everyone.
The station is equipped with an induction loop, helpful customer information screens, and clear announcements to keep you informed of your journey. While there are no waiting rooms, the station does offer seating areas where passengers can rest comfortably. Refreshment facilities are available for those in need of a quick snack, and an ATM machine ensures access to cash when needed.
Purley Station is well-connected to various modes of transportation, facilitating easy transitions between different travel methods. For those needing taxis, a taxi rank is conveniently located outside both entrances of the station. If you prefer bus travel, information about services is readily available at the station, guiding you through local routes with ease. While the station lacks a dedicated car rental section, you'll find that public transport options are ample for most needs.
Many travelers find Purley Station an ideal starting point for exploring major destinations. Some of the popular routes include journeys to London's key stations such as London Bridge, London Victoria, and East Croydon. Additionally, it serves as a gateway to Gatwick Airport, making it an excellent choice for international travelers.
Other noteworthy destinations accessible from Purley include Farringdon, Clapham Junction, and London Blackfriars. Whether heading for business meetings or leisurely visits, Purley's connectivity ensures an efficient start to any journey.
